Classic Baby Names That Never Go Out of Style
Classic names have a timeless charm that just feels right no matter the era. They often carry a rich history and a sense of familiarity that many parents find comforting. These names are perfect if you want your child’s name to age gracefully with them.
Here are some beloved classics that have stood the test of time and remain popular choices for baby boys and girls alike.
Let’s explore these ageless favorites.
1. Emma – A beloved name meaning “universal,” Emma has a gentle yet strong presence that feels warm and welcoming.
2. James – A regal and traditional name meaning “supplanter,” perfect for parents who appreciate history and dignity.
3. Olivia – Meaning “olive tree,” this graceful name has a melodic quality that’s both classic and fresh.
4. William – A noble name meaning “resolute protector,” often linked with strength and leadership.
5. Charlotte – Feminine and elegant, this name means “free man” and carries royal connotations.
6. Benjamin – A warm and friendly name meaning “son of the right hand,” full of kindness and tradition.
7. Grace – Simple yet profound, Grace embodies elegance and goodwill, perfect for a gentle soul.
8. Henry – A classic royal name meaning “estate ruler,” offering a solid and timeless feel.
9. Sophia – Meaning “wisdom,” this name is both beautiful and smart, a favorite for many parents.
10. Alexander – Strong and heroic, this name means “defender of the people,” great for a brave little one.
11. Elizabeth – A name with regal roots meaning “pledged to God,” it exudes grace and strength.
12. Michael – Meaning “who is like God,” this name is a classic with a powerful presence.
13. Isabella – Romantic and timeless, Isabella means “devoted to God” and has a lovely lyrical sound.
14. David – A strong, biblical name meaning “beloved,” it’s both simple and deeply meaningful.
15. Mia – Short and sweet, Mia means “mine” and feels modern despite its classic roots.

Powerful Baby Names Inspired by History
Some parents love names that carry a sense of history and strength, connecting their child to remarkable people who made a difference. These names can inspire courage, wisdom, and ambition.
Whether from ancient times or more recent history, these names come with stories that elevate their charm and significance. They’re perfect for babies destined to make their own mark.
Here are inspiring names from history worth considering.
31. Cleopatra – The name of the last Egyptian queen, symbolizing beauty and intelligence.
32. Nelson – After Nelson Mandela, this name stands for resilience and justice.
33. Joan – Inspired by Joan of Arc, a symbol of courage and conviction.
34. Leonardo – After the Renaissance genius Leonardo da Vinci, perfect for a creative mind.
35. Harriet – Honoring Harriet Tubman, this name evokes bravery and freedom.
36. Alexander – Inspired by Alexander the Great, a name full of leadership and strength.
37. Elizabeth – After Queen Elizabeth I, symbolizing power and intelligence.
38. Winston – For Winston Churchill, a name associated with resilience and determination.
39. Amelia – Honoring Amelia Earhart, representing adventure and pioneering spirit.
40. Martin – After Martin Luther King Jr., a symbol of hope and change.
41. Victoria – Named for Queen Victoria, this name implies strength and dignity.
42. Benjamin – Inspired by Benjamin Franklin, a name for a thinker and innovator.
43. Rosa – After Rosa Parks, representing courage and social justice.
44. Julius – Named for Julius Caesar, a name with imperial power and historic weight.
45. Sophia – Meaning “wisdom,” also inspired by historical figures known for intellect.
